Output bb2211524dafb8d517798d7d092ea2e8f3f570966bdcfec8b384629a75015049:0

value
16105681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5425b99d6b621e2f1c4ea2199f52964caf77ef4d OP_EQUAL
address
39MwsqhjQHVNx8oto33c8rXQz1mBBRj7ZP
transaction
bb2211524dafb8d517798d7d092ea2e8f3f570966bdcfec8b384629a75015049
spent
true